Q1

If \( \alpha, \beta \) are natural numbers such that \(\begin{array}{r}100^{\alpha}-199 \beta=(100)(100)+(99)(101) +(98)(102)+\ldots \ldots+(1)(199)\end{array}\) ,then the slope of the line passing through \( (\alpha, \beta) \) and origin is :

[JEE Main 2021, 18 Mar (Shift 1)]

a

\(540\)

b

\(550\)

c

\(530\)

d

\(510\)
